To find the measure of one exterior angle of a polygon, you can use the formula:
\[ \text{Exterior Angle} = \frac{360°}{n} \]
where \(n\) is the number of sides of the polygon.
For a polygon with five sides (a pentagon), we substitute \(n = 5\):
\[ \text{Exterior Angle} = \frac{360°}{5} = 72° \]
Therefore, the measure of any one exterior angle of a pentagon is 72°.
